Output a687832e291707d96fc25947f583ec3ea2297822758fbfd64838dff7223bb76a:2

value
53706668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a801ee5191d880870b042374087863b8e126ab6b OP_EQUAL
address
MPDW4paptRmfQVLrPDHetxjmEWipUP4LnH
transaction
a687832e291707d96fc25947f583ec3ea2297822758fbfd64838dff7223bb76a
spent
true